    Fine FMG 585HD vs Mahindra Roadmaster G100: Which Motor Grader Suits Your Work?

    The Fine FMG 585HD and the Mahindra Roadmaster G100 both handle road grading, but they aim at different buyers. The Fine FMG 585HD carries more engine power and a longer blade, so it suits heavier grading loads. The Mahindra Roadmaster G100 travels faster and comes with GPS built in, which can help a fleet owner track the machine and move it between sites quickly.

    A contractor grading tough or uneven ground may prefer the Fine FMG 585HD for its extra power and blade length. A fleet owner who moves the grader often between small road jobs may lean toward the Mahindra Roadmaster G100 for its speed and built-in tracking.     Fine FMG 585HD

    Pros:

    • Higher engine power output of 130 HP
    • Higher torque of 480 Nm
    • Larger blade length of 3050 mm
    • More advanced hydraulic system with load sensing axial piston pump
    • Greater maximum lift above ground at 460 mm
    • Optional AC cabin for comfort

    Cons:

    • Lower maximum forward and reverse speeds at 20 km/hr and 19 km/hr respectively
    • Larger minimum turning radius of 9000 mm
    • Does not come with GPS as a standard feature

    Mahindra Roadmaster G100

    Pros:

    • Higher forward speed of 32.5 km/hr
    • GPS comes as a standard feature
    • Blade has specified cutting edge and thickness
    • Greater blade down pressure and pull capacity at 2753 kgf
    • Goes into gear faster and smoother with Carraro 4WD Powershift Transmission
    • Larger fuel tank for extended operation times

    Cons:

    • Lower engine power output of 102 HP
    • Smaller blade size compared to Fine FMG 585HD
    • Lower torque of 440 Nm
    • Slower reverse speed at 9.5 km/hr

    Quick Overview:

    The Mahindra RoadMaster G100 is a high-performance grader machine designed for large infrastructure and highway projects in India. It has proven itself in Indian conditions, offering durability and precision in demanding environments. As part of Mahindra’s grader machine range, it is powered by a Mahindra 102 HP turbocharged engine that generates 440 Nm of torque, facilitating efficient levelling and site preparation. The advanced hydraulic system with high working pressure allows smooth and precise blade control. Its 3000 mm moldboard and 50° rotation provide better finishing and quicker results. A heavy-duty dozer blade and optional ripper enhance performance on hard surfaces. The powershift transmission and differential lock improve control and traction. The Mahindra G100 motor grader price in India starts from ₹51 lakhs. Widely recognized among Mahindra construction machinery solutions for road-building projects, this Mahindra grader is suitable for contractors involved in large-scale road construction projects.

    The Fine Equipments FMG 585HD is a compact grader machine in India designed for road construction and land development projects. It suits contractors working on small to medium infrastructure and grading projects. Powered by a 130 HP Ashok Leyland diesel engine, it delivers strong torque at low RPM for heavy-duty tasks. The fuel-efficient engine helps lower operating costs during long hours. Its 3.05-meter moldboard promotes better grading productivity with fewer passes. The load-sensing hydraulic system allows for precise blade control and quicker response. Power-shift transmission ensures smooth operation and better control on tight job sites. Articulation and steering enhance maneuverability in confined areas. The operator cabin is designed for comfort, visibility, and easy controls to boost productivity. The Fine FMG 585HD motor grader price in India is expected to range from ₹40 to ₹50 lakh.     Mahindra Roadmaster G100 Vs Fine FMG 585HD Motor Grader Specifications

    Engine

    Mahindra Roadmaster G100 Fine FMG 585HD
    Model Mahindra 102 HP Ashok Leyland 130 HP
    Fuel Diesel Diesel
    Type CEV-V; Water Cooled; Turbo Charged Four Stroke; Turbocharged; Charge Air Cooled; Electronic Common Rail Direct Injection
    Gross Power 102 HP (76 kW) @ 2000 rpm 130 HP (97 kW) @ 2200 rpm
    Number Of Cylinders 4 4 in-line
    Max Torque 440 Nm @ 1200–1500 rpm 480 Nm @ 1500 rpm
    Displacement 3.5 L 3.84 L
    Battery 12V / 100 Ah 12V / 180Ah
    Alternator 12V / 90 A 12V / 90A

    Transmission

    Mahindra Roadmaster G100 Fine FMG 585HD
    Type Carraro 4WD Powershift Transmission with 4 Forward and 4 Reverse Gears Power-Shift Transmission

    Speed

    Mahindra Roadmaster G100 Fine FMG 585HD
    Max. Forward Speed 32.5 km/hr 20 km/hr
    Max. Reverse Speed 9.5 km/hr 19 km/hr

    Axles

    Mahindra Roadmaster G100 Fine FMG 585HD
    Rear Axle Driven; Non Steerable; Central Pivoted Heavy-duty tandem axle with central planetary reduction with no spin differential lock. Tandem Axle with hydraulic service brake and SAHR parking brake.
    Front Axle Non-driven; Streerable Central Pivoted Fully welded steel structure for torsional strength.

    Tyres

    Mahindra Roadmaster G100 Fine FMG 585HD
    Size 13 x 24-12 PR 11 x 20"

    Steering

    Mahindra Roadmaster G100 Fine FMG 585HD
    Type Power Steering Hydraulic power steering
    Minimum Turning Radius 10000 mm 9000 mm
    Steering-Angle 45° 45°

    Brakes

    Mahindra Roadmaster G100 Fine FMG 585HD
    Service Foot operated hydraulically actuated oil immersed disc in the middle axle. Foot pedal operated hydraulic brake through master cylinder.
    Parking Hand operated , mechanically actuated caliper brakes system. Spring Applied; Hydraulic Release Type parking brake operated through solenoid.

    Frame

    Mahindra Roadmaster G100 Fine FMG 585HD
    Front Frame Height NA NA
    Front Frame Width NA NA
    Front Frame Thickness NA NA

    MoldBoard

    Mahindra Roadmaster G100 Fine FMG 585HD
    Type NA NA
    Blade Length 3000 mm 3050 mm
    Blade Height 516 mm 494 mm
    Blade Thickness 16 mm NA
    Cutting Edge 152 x 16 NA
    Blade Pull 2753 kgf NA
    Blade Down Pressure 2753 kgf NA
    Moldboard Side Shift (Right/Left) 513 mm 914 mm
    Maximum Shoulder Reach (Right/Left) 489.5 mm 744 mm
    Maximum Lift Above Ground 395 mm 460 mm
    Maximum Cutting Depth 300 mm NA
    Blade Pitch Angle 40° forward; 5° backward 40° forward; 3° backward

    Hydraulics

    Mahindra Roadmaster G100 Fine FMG 585HD
    Type Open Center - Fixed Displacement Tandem Gear Pump Closer Centre -Variable flow; load sensing axial piston pump with load-independent post-compensated valve with over-centre valve on all functions.
    Maximum Pump Flow 96 L/min 118 L/min
    Maximum System Pressure 21 MPa 22.0 MPa

    Service Capacities

    Mahindra Roadmaster G100 Fine FMG 585HD
    Fuel Tank 100 L 140 L
    Cooling System 17 L 18 L
    Engine Oil 13.5 L 10 L
    DEF Tank NA NA
    Trasnsmission Oil 16 L 35 L
    Final Drive NA NA
    Hydraulic System 60 L 150 L
    Circle Reverse Housing NA 5 L

    Weight

    Mahindra Roadmaster G100 Fine FMG 585HD
    Gross Vehicle Weight 9010 kg 9495 kg
    Moldboard Base 1691 mm 2100 mm
    Wheelbase 5225 mm 5300 mm
    Tandem Wheelbase 1850 mm 1300 mm
    Width of Standard Moldboard 3000 mm 3050 mm
    Overall Length 9270 mm 9100 mm
    Tread Gauge 1674 mm (Front) / 1754 mm (Rear) NA
    Width of Tires 2021 mm (Front) / 2001 mm (Rear) 2050 mm
    Articulation, left or right NA 20°
    Minimum Ground Clearence 467 mm NA

    The Mahindra Roadmaster G100 is a motor grader used for road building and levelling work. It travels faster than many other graders in its class and comes with GPS built in, which helps with tracking and site planning. It has less engine power than the Fine FMG 585HD.

    Ans.

    The Fine FMG 585HD has more engine power than the Mahindra Roadmaster G100. More power helps when grading harder or uneven ground. The Mahindra makes up for the lower power with a higher travel speed and a smoother-shifting transmission.

    Ans.

    No, the Fine FMG 585HD does not come with GPS as standard. If tracking your grader matters for your fleet, the Mahindra Roadmaster G100 has GPS built in from the start. Ask your dealer about add-on tracking options for the Fine model if you still prefer it.

    Ans.

    The Fine FMG 585HD has the longer blade of the two graders. A longer blade covers more ground in a single pass, which can save time on wide roads. The Mahindra Roadmaster G100 has a shorter blade but higher blade down pressure for pushing through packed ground.
